Rapid Advancements in AI Transform Robot Training

Recent developments in artificial intelligence are significantly accelerating the training process for robots, enabling them to learn new tasks almost instantaneously. This leap in technology is set to revolutionize various industries, as robots become increasingly capable of adapting to different environments and requirements without extensive programming.

Traditionally, training robots has been a time-consuming process, often requiring manual programming and numerous iterations to achieve desired functionality. However, with the integration of advanced AI algorithms, robots can now leverage machine learning techniques to understand and execute tasks with minimal human intervention. This not only enhances their operational efficiency but also reduces the time and resources needed for training.

As businesses seek to improve productivity and reduce costs, the ability of robots to quickly learn and adapt to new challenges is becoming a crucial asset. Industries such as manufacturing, logistics, and healthcare stand to benefit immensely from these advancements, paving the way for a future where robots can seamlessly integrate into various workflows. The ongoing evolution of AI technology promises to unlock even greater potential for robotic applications in the years to come.
